Genuine vs. Compatible Parts: Making Informed Kobelco Maintenance Choices



Heavy machinery operations demand constant financial vigilance. Plant managers navigate endless budget constraints. When critical components reach replacement intervals, price evaluation begins instantly. The genuine manufactured option appears first. Then the compatible substitute emerges. The cost spread captures immediate attention. Regularly 50-75% difference exists. That margin creates intense selection pressure. But veteran equipment supervisors investigate comprehensively before deciding.

The choice between genuine and compatible components transcends simple expense comparison. It requires assessing system dependability, operational schedules, and crew welfare protocols. Field experience demonstrates both categories serve legitimate operational needs. Both also harbor distinct risk elements. Understanding these boundaries enables strategic maintenance management.

Acquisition Expense vs. Comprehensive Ownership Cost

Let's address the pricing reality directly. Genuine components carry substantial cost premiums. These prices fund engineering programs, quality assurance systems, and manufacturer guarantee infrastructure. Compatible producers operate outside these cost structures. Their pricing advantages reflect this operational efficiency.

However, the purchase transaction represents merely the initial financial outlay. Complete ownership analysis reveals accurate economics. Envision this sequence: a budget-friendly component fails prematurely during critical project phase. Emergency procurement follows. Technical crews execute installation procedures repeatedly. Meanwhile, production equipment sits idle, losing revenue capability. If the incident cascades into adjacent system damage, repair costs multiply substantially. A genuine component might operate reliably across extended service periods. When evaluated across total operating hours, authentic components frequently prove more economical.

Dimensional Accuracy and Assembly Compatibility

Kobelco crane systems represent precision-engineered equipment. Every subsystem requires geometric harmony within defined tolerance bands. Slewing drives, hydraulic circuits, and anti-friction bearing assemblies demand exact specification adherence. Authentic Kobelco crane parts mirror original production tolerances precisely.

Compatible manufacturing quality exhibits significant variation. Some producers analyze original components for replication. They achieve functional similarity while missing critical precision elements. Mounting interfaces might locate marginally off-center. Seal profiles could vary microscopically. These seemingly insignificant deviations generate substantial operational impacts. Installation may require field modification or force-fitting. Such practices induce mechanical stress concentrations. Eventually, stress accumulation translates into structural fractures or fluid leakage paths.

Genuine components eliminate fitment speculation. Technical staff proceed confidently, knowing proper assembly requires no alteration. Work completion occurs efficiently. This efficiency conserves labor resources. More importantly, it preserves the engineering integrity the manufacturer designed into the system.

Material Integrity and Durability Performance

Substance specification determines behavior under operational loads. This factor frequently remains invisible until service failure. Genuine components utilize specific alloy grades and elastomer compounds validated through extensive heavy equipment protocols. They resist thermal degradation, pressure cycling, and vibrational fatigue.

Compatible alternatives occasionally compromise material specifications to achieve price targets. Steel processing might lack proper metallurgical treatment. Elastomer formulations in dynamic seals could deteriorate rapidly under temperature stress. For primary load-bearing applications, material quality becomes paramount. A boom attachment fastener fabricated from substandard metallurgy might fracture under working loads. A hydraulic seal using economy rubber compounds will harden and leak prematurely.

Visual assessment rarely reveals these critical differences. Components may present identically in inventory bins. Actual performance under working conditions exposes material deficiencies. This reality justifies investment in authentic Kobelco crane parts for demanding applications. Operational reliability and personnel safety warrant material certainty.

Appropriate Compatible Applications

We must acknowledge that compatible solutions aren't inherently problematic. Quality compatible manufacturers serve the industry effectively. For suitable non-critical applications, they present viable alternatives. Items such as filtration media, illumination components, or standard hardware often perform acceptably as compatible selections.

When reputable third-party brands produce filters meeting OEM specifications, these represent sensible choices. When operator seating or protective trim requires replacement, genuine sourcing becomes unnecessary. Allocate financial resources strategically. Invest in hydraulic systems, electronic controls, and structural elements. Deploy compatible solutions for consumables and cosmetic items. Always verify technical specifications match application requirements.

Critical System Components: Risk Management Priorities

Certain applications carry too much consequence for component compromise. Main hydraulic pumps, primary control valves, and safety instrumentation fall into this category. Their failure halts operations. Dangerous failures threaten personnel safety.

For these applications, insist on genuine components exclusively. Engineering risks outweigh potential savings. A faulty sensor might bypass safety limits. A weak pump could release suspended loads unexpectedly. When you procure Kobelco crane parts for these critical systems, you purchase operational certainty. You ensure the machine operates within its safe design parameters.

Decision Framework Establishment

How should you evaluate specific situations? Examine the application context. Does the component influence safety or core performance? Is replacement access difficult? When full machine disassembly becomes necessary for replacement, specify premium components. You don't want to perform that work twice.

Is the part easy to swap? Is it non-critical? Then compatible options might suffice. Check product reviews. Ask your crane parts supplier for their recommendations. They see what fails and what lasts in actual field conditions. Their feedback proves invaluable.

Maintain detailed procurement records. Track component service life performance. If compatible filters require more frequent replacement, note it. If genuine seals demonstrate superior longevity, record that too. Systematic data collection enables strategy refinement. Over time, you'll identify optimal savings opportunities and necessary investment areas.

How to Ensure Kobelco Crane Parts Are Compatible with Your Machine


Kobelco cranes are built to withstand demanding conditions, but regular maintenance is key to their longevity. When a component wears out, choosing the right Kobelco crane parts is crucial, as compatibility varies by model, year, and serial number. Ordering the wrong part can result in downtime, costly repairs, or safety hazards. By following a clear process, you can work with a crane parts supplier to ensure the parts you order are the right fit for your equipment.

Here’s how to verify compatibility for Kobelco crane parts to keep your crane running reliably.

Why Compatibility Matters

Cranes operate under intense pressure, lifting heavy loads and enduring harsh environments. When a part fails, replacing it with the correct Kobelco crane parts is essential for safety and performance. A mismatched component can cause significant problems.

For example, a hydraulic cylinder with incorrect specifications might lead to uneven lifting or system damage. An electrical component with the wrong firmware could disrupt critical functions, leaving the crane inoperable. Consulting a reputable crane parts supplier ensures you get parts that match your crane’s requirements.

Step 1: Determine the Crane’s Model

Start by identifying your crane’s model number. Kobelco uses codes to indicate the crane’s type—crawler, rough terrain, or truck crane—and its lifting capacity. This code is usually found on a nameplate attached to the crane or in the operator’s documentation.

However, models evolve over time. A Kobelco CKE1800 from 1999, for instance, may use different parts than one from 2010 due to design changes. The model number is just the starting point for ensuring compatibility.

Step 2: Check the Year of Manufacture

The production year is a critical factor in part compatibility. Kobelco frequently updates its cranes, making changes to components like hydraulic fittings or control systems. A part designed for a 2004 model might not fit a 2014 version of the same crane.

For example, a counterweight for a Kobelco 7250 could differ between years due to changes in mounting designs. Always include the year when sourcing Kobelco crane parts to avoid errors.

Step 3: Provide the Serial Number

The serial number is your crane’s unique identifier, offering the most accurate way to confirm compatibility. Found on the nameplate or in the crane’s records, it reveals specific production details. This is especially important for mid-production changes, such as when Kobelco updates a slew gear or hydraulic hose.

Providing the serial number to a crane parts supplier ensures they can match the part to your crane’s exact configuration, eliminating guesswork.

Step 4: Refer to Parts Manuals

Kobelco’s parts manuals are a valuable tool, providing detailed diagrams, part numbers, and compatibility information for each model and year. Use these manuals to verify the correct Kobelco crane parts by cross-checking your crane’s model, year, and serial number.

If you don’t have access to a manual, a trusted crane parts supplier can retrieve this information for you. Provide your crane’s details, and they can confirm the correct part numbers.

Step 5: Confirm with a Crane Parts Supplier

Before placing an order, consult a crane parts supplier to verify compatibility. Suppliers with Kobelco expertise can clarify complexities, such as superseded parts or interchangeable components. They can also provide information on availability and delivery timelines, helping you avoid project delays.

For instance, if a specific hydraulic motor is discontinued, a supplier might suggest a compatible alternative. This guidance ensures you get the right Kobelco crane parts and keeps your crane operational.

Common Areas for Compatibility Issues

Certain Kobelco crane parts are more likely to cause problems if mismatched:

  • Hydraulic Systems: Pumps, valves, and hoses can vary by year or serial number, with differences in pressure or fittings.
  • Electrical Components: Sensors and wiring harnesses may change with software or connector updates.
  • Undercarriage Parts: Tracks and sprockets often differ in size or mounting patterns, affecting performance if incorrect.
  • Engine Components: Kobelco uses engines from brands like Isuzu, and parts like fuel pumps may vary by engine version.

Paying close attention to these areas prevents costly mistakes.

The Cost of Getting It Wrong

Using the wrong Kobelco crane parts can lead to serious consequences. Downtime is a major issue—cranes are vital to job sites, and delays can escalate costs. A mismatched part, like an incompatible slew bearing, could also cause mechanical stress, damaging other components.

Safety is the greatest concern. A part that doesn’t meet specifications, such as a faulty hydraulic valve, could lead to unstable lifts or equipment failure, endangering workers. Thorough compatibility checks are critical to avoid these risks.

Tips for Streamlined Ordering

To make ordering Kobelco crane parts more efficient:

  • Maintain a log of your crane fleet, including model, year, and serial numbers, for quick reference.
  • Record part numbers for commonly replaced items, like filters or gaskets, to simplify reordering.
  • Work with a crane parts supplier who specializes in Kobelco equipment. Their knowledge can prevent errors and speed up the process.

These practices save time and ensure accuracy.
